How We Extract Sewage Water in Castleberry, AL

Our process is designed to extract sewage water quickly and effectively, reducing the risk of further damage and health hazards. Here's what you can expect:

Arrival and Assessment

We'll arrive on the scene within 60 minutes of your call, equipped with the latest equipment and a thorough understanding of the challenges of sewage water extraction. Our technicians will assess the situation, identify the source of the contamination, and develop a plan to extract the sewage water safely and efficiently.

Water Extraction and Removal

Using state-of-the-art equipment, including truck-mounted extractors and portable pumps, we'll remove the sewage water from your property, reducing the risk of further damage and health hazards. Our technicians will work diligently to restore your home to a safe and healthy environment.

Sanitizing and Disinfecting

Once the water has been removed, we'll sanitize and disinfect your home to remove any remaining bacteria, viruses, and other contaminants. Our technicians will use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to ensure your home is safe and healthy.

Drying and Dehumidification

Finally, we'll use industrial-strength dehumidifiers and air movers to dry out your home and remove any remaining moisture. This is crucial in preventing further damage and mold growth.

Final Inspection and Cleanup

Once the drying and dehumidification process is complete, we'll conduct a final inspection to ensure your home is safe and healthy. We'll also clean up any debris or equipment, leaving your home looking like new.

Sewage Water Extraction Cost in Castleberry, AL

The cost of sewage water extraction in Castleberry, AL can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ated prices for common sewage water extraction services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ment rental fees.
Sanitizing and disinfecting $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, type of sanitizing equipment used, and labor costs.
Drying and dehumidification $300 - $1,500 Size of affected area, type of dehumidification equipment used, and labor costs.
Final inspection and cleanup $100 - $500 Size of affected area, type of cleaning equipment used, and labor costs.
Equipment rental and labor costs $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ment rented, and labor costs.

Common Questions About Sewage Water Extraction

Q: How long does sewage water extraction take?

A: The time it takes to complete sewage water extraction depends on the size of the affected area, the severity of the damage, and the type of equipment used. Typically, our team can complete the job within 24-48 hours.

Q: Is sewage water extraction covered by insurance?

A: Yes, sewage water extraction is usually covered by homeowners' insurance policies. But, the specifics of your policy may vary, so it's best to check with your insurance provider.

Q: What causes sewage water contamination?

A: Sewage water contamination can be caused by a variety of factors, including clogged drains, burst pipes, and heavy rainfall. Our team can help you identify the source of the contamination and develop a plan to prevent future issues.

Q: How do I prevent sewage water contamination?

A: To prevent sewage water contamination, it's essential to maintain your home's plumbing system, inspect your drains regularly, and address any issues quickly. Our team can provide you with personalized advice and guidance to help you prevent sewage water contamination.
